Mellandatabaser
Mellandatabaser are databases used as intermediaries in data processing pipelines. They sit between operational databases (OLTP systems) and analytics or reporting systems (data warehouses or data marts). Data is extracted from source systems, loaded into mellandatabaser, transformed and cleansed, and then moved on to downstream stores. Mellandatabaser can be temporary or persist as semi-permanent stores, depending on the use case.
